A professional recruitment agency is seeking an Unqualified Nursery Assistant for a part-time position in Wimbledon. The role involves assisting with daily nursery activities from 2pm to 6pm, Monday to Friday.
Candidates should demonstrate a positive attitude, be passionate about childcare, and have some experience in a nursery setting. This position offers opportunities for genuine career progression within an established nursery.

How to prepare for a job interview at Acer Recruitment
✨Show Your Passion for Childcare
Make sure to express your enthusiasm for working with children during the interview. Share specific experiences that highlight your love for childcare, whether it's a memorable moment from a previous role or a personal story that showcases your commitment.
✨Prepare for Common Questions
Think about the types of questions you might be asked, such as how you would handle a challenging situation with a child or how you promote a positive learning environment. Practising your answers can help you feel more confident and articulate during the interview.
✨Demonstrate a Positive Attitude
Since the job requires a positive attitude, make sure to convey this throughout your interview. Smile, maintain eye contact, and show your eagerness to contribute to the nursery's environment. A cheerful disposition can go a long way in making a great impression.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are a few questions to ask the interviewer about the nursery's approach to childcare or opportunities for professional development. This shows that you're genuinely interested in the role and eager to grow within the organisation.
